This data includes the results of computer simulations for the article "Mitigating boundary effects in finite temperature simulations of false vacuum decay". We simulate first order false vacuum decay in a range of spinor gases (pseudo-spin-1/2 potassium-39, pseudo-spin-1/2 sodium-23, spin-1 rubidium-87) using the Stochastic Projected Gross-Pitaevskii equation. We examine the evolution of each system in both the presence and absence of boundaries.
